Output 66fe3d07fbbe5326a68f62857ddb03e16afb963264747619ab3e828240f0dd92:0

value
120351426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 429cc46c1bceafe06301d9232f070637333c28d3 OP_EQUAL
address
MDyNdULhv1UxrbJ56JAHf43JnfRFTux34s
transaction
66fe3d07fbbe5326a68f62857ddb03e16afb963264747619ab3e828240f0dd92
spent
true